What Is NSFW AI?
NSFW AI refers to artificial intelligence models specifically trained to recognize, generate, or filter content deemed inappropriate or explicit in nature. This could range from explicit images or videos to suggestive text or audio. The primary function of these models revolves around either detecting such content or, in some cases, generating it. A large number of tools have emerged in this niche market, promising both content moderation and content creation capabilities.
NSFW AI typically falls into two broad categories:
- Content Detection: These AI models are used to scan images, videos, or text and flag content that violates community guidelines or platforms’ terms of service. For example, social media platforms and websites with user-generated content rely on AI to identify explicit or inappropriate material.
- Content Generation: This segment of NSFW AI includes deep learning models like Generative Adversarial Networks (GANs) and other advanced neural networks that can generate adult content, either visual or textual. This area has sparked a lot of discussion regarding the potential for misuse, manipulation, and privacy violations.
The Technology Behind NSFW AI
NSFW AI is built on complex neural networks, primarily using computer vision and natural language processing (NLP). These models are trained using vast datasets consisting of millions of labeled examples of adult content. Through deep learning techniques, AI can learn to identify patterns and features that distinguish NSFW content from non-NSFW material.
- Computer Vision: For visual NSFW content, AI employs computer vision algorithms to analyze and classify images and videos. The models learn to identify specific features such as nudity, explicit gestures, or sexual content. The dataset used for training these systems often includes a mix of explicit content and general images, enabling the model to distinguish between what is considered “safe” and what is considered “unsafe.”
- Natural Language Processing (NLP): In the case of text-based NSFW content, NLP models are designed to analyze written material for suggestive language, profane terms, or adult themes. These models are highly sensitive to context and can flag text across platforms like social media, chatrooms, and websites.
- Generative Models: For generating NSFW content, GANs are used to create realistic images, video clips, or even entire scenes that contain explicit material. These systems learn from existing content and can generate new material that mimics real-life situations, but they also open up new possibilities for misuse, such as creating deepfakes or non-consensual explicit imagery.
Ethical Implications and Risks
The development and use of NSFW AI raise several ethical concerns that need to be addressed thoughtfully and responsibly.
- Consent and Privacy Violations: One of the most significant ethical concerns surrounding NSFW AI is its potential for misuse in the creation of non-consensual explicit content. AI-generated deepfakes, for example, can be used to superimpose a person’s face onto explicit material without their consent, violating privacy and causing significant harm to individuals’ reputations.
- Misinformation and Manipulation: NSFW AI can also be used to manipulate images, videos, and text to spread false narratives, particularly in the form of fake news or harmful propaganda. Such content can damage individuals’ careers, relationships, and mental health.
- Regulation and Accountability: Governments and tech companies are increasingly under pressure to regulate the use of AI in adult content creation and moderation. However, establishing comprehensive regulations is complicated due to the rapid pace at which AI technology is evolving. A lack of regulatory clarity can create loopholes that allow for unethical practices and exploitation.
- Gender and Racial Bias: Like many AI models, NSFW AI systems can inherit biases from their training data. These biases can perpetuate stereotypes and discriminatory practices, further marginalizing certain groups. For example, AI might over-flag content created by women or people of color, or it may misidentify explicit material based on certain racial or gendered patterns.
The Positive Use Cases for NSFW AI
Despite the ethical challenges, NSFW AI also has potential for positive use cases, particularly in moderation and content filtering.
- Content Moderation: Platforms like social media networks, online forums, and streaming services rely heavily on AI to enforce community standards and prevent the distribution of explicit material that violates guidelines. NSFW AI can efficiently identify and remove harmful or inappropriate content at scale, allowing human moderators to focus on more complex issues.
- Enhancing Safe Online Environments: In environments like educational platforms, children’s apps, or family-friendly websites, NSFW AI can be used to ensure that users are not exposed to harmful or explicit material. These systems can act as a safeguard to protect vulnerable populations.
- Adult Industry Regulations: In the adult entertainment industry, AI tools can help ensure that all content is produced consensually and adheres to legal requirements. Additionally, AI can assist in ensuring the well-being and privacy of performers by moderating and controlling explicit material that circulates on the internet.
